CeMnNi4: an impostor half-metal

I. I. Mazin

cond-mat.mtrl-sciarXiv:cond-mat/0510400

Abstract

Recent experiments show CeMnNi4 to have a nearly integer magnetic moment and a relatively large transport spin polarization, as probed by Andreev reflection, suggesting that the material is a half metal or close to it. However, the calculations reported here show that it is not a half metal at all, but rather a semimetal of an unusual nature. Phonon properties should also be quite unusual, with rattling low-frequency Mn modes. Nontrivial transport properties, including a large thermolectric figure of merit, ZT, are predicted in the ferromagnetic state of the well ordered stoichiometric CeMnNi4
